Output 96d8697186263d636a83f7a3f5aa7c67083fde29338e72536a8d155dc44608a3:1

value
959746
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6fe6b3c07fb91837a152cc9a3263864bb124ebe6 OP_EQUAL
address
3BthJJa4aPCiXBHnnVzjh9HxCynzWRJ1HB
transaction
96d8697186263d636a83f7a3f5aa7c67083fde29338e72536a8d155dc44608a3
spent
true